GROWING.
Tho races for tho Licensed Victuallers’ Shield bctwen the Gisborno and Poverty Bay Rowing Clubs will eventuate on Saturday afternoon next. In addition to these there will bo an exhibition sculling event between Mr. W. "Webb (world’s champion) and Mr, Rees Jones (the local champion). Tho following oilicials have been appointed for tho several events: — Starter, Mr. Albert Robinson; umpire, Mr. \V. Hackett; judge, Mr. G. 15. Oman. The Harbor Board are to be asked to place their launch at tho disposal of the umpire. Tho following is tho programme and order of events: 2 p.m., Senior Race, 2 miles; 2.30 p.m.. Exhibition Sculling Event botween W. Webb and Rees Jones; 3 p.m., Junior Race, 1 mile; 3.15 p.m., Ist heat Gisborno Club’s Maiden Sculls; 3.30 p.m., 2nd heat Gisborne Club’s Maiden Sculls; 3.45 p.m., Tenstone Crews. Poverty Bay havo drawn No. 2 position and Gisborno No. 1 position for tho Senior Race (No. 1 position is on tho town side of the river). For the Junior and Tonstono races Poverty Bay havo drawn the town sido and Gisborno tho Kaiti sido of the river. Tho senior race will in all probability bo rowed on tho Tarukeru river, finishing at tho Gisborne Club’s boathouse. Tho committee meet at 10 a.m. on Saturday to consider whether it is advisable to row it from tho harbor inwards, in which case it will finish opposite the freezing works. All tho other events will bo rowed on the Waimata course, finishing at tho end of tho wharf. No doubt Mr. W. AYebb’s action in offering to givo an exhibition for the benefit of local oarsmen will be greatly appreciated, and a record crowd is expected to view Saturday’s events.
